Inspiration

Our inspiration for Skillscapade came from the need for a unique twist on more "corporate" learning platforms, offering a way for users to engage with content in a way that feels less like a chore and more like an adventure. We wanted to create a tool that would empower individuals and organizations to design customized, gamified learning experiences that not only teach new skills, but also inspire a sense of curiosity, exploration, and achievement. With Skillscapade, we hope to revolutionize how people think about learning and make education more enjoyable and effective for everyone.

What it does

  • Users can create an account using Google and view the profile page.
  • Users can access some courses that are already made by creators, and collect points.

How we built it

  • Angular web framework in the background
  • Dynamic calls to Google Firebase for documenting
  • Secure SSO sign in with Fireauth

Challenges we ran into

  • User identification
    • hard to do securely
  • asynchronous communication
    • hard to update in real time
    • accomplished using RxJS observable/subscriber models

Accomplishments that we're proud of

  • We're proud to say that we have a minimum viable product working--please make an account on https://skillscapade.tech and find out for yourself!
  • Secure, data visualizations update in real time

What we learned

  • Lots of Angular backend development
  • The Angularfire API for configuring and using Firebase with Angular
  • Stenganography and finance, for tract research

What's next for Skillscapade

  • We plan to add quick and easy editing tools for users and companies to upload and edit their own content tracts for use in learning about niche subjects and corporate training on the material.
  • We also plan to make a system that would track course popularity and use machine learning to cluster similar courses and recommend different courses to users automatically.

Built With

Share this project:

Updates